Steelwork and Slag Processing Industry | Bunting Redditch

The most common method of recovering steel is when crushed slag is fed onto the surface of a heavy-duty Electro or Permanent drum magnet. Magnetic material is attracted to the strong magnetic field of the stationary magnetic element inside the drum and then moved and deposited underneath and away from the slag through the motion of the rotating …

Environmental and Socioeconomic Impact of Copper Slag…

Copper slag is generated when copper and nickel ores are recovered from their parent ores using a pyrometallurgical process, and these ores usually contain other elements which include iron, cobalt, silica, and alumina. Slag is a major problem in the metallurgical industries as it is dumped into heaps which have accumulated into millions …

Steel Slag Processing Line

The metal contained in steel slag has strong magnetic properties, so the coarse and selective selection should be used magnetic separation method. The processing process is: after the steel slag is coarsely crushed, it is crushed, screened and magnetically separated from the magnetic materials and non-magnetic materials.

Development of a Process to Recycle NdFeB Permanent Magnets …

A two-step process is presented that (i) creates an FeOx-CaO-Al2O3-REE2O3 molten slag at 1500 °C through oxidative smelting and (ii) separates an iron-depleted slag phase (CaO-Al2O3-REE2O3) and a molten iron phase via carbothermic or metallothermic reduction at 1700–2000 °C.

9 Metals That Are Not Magnetic

Are all Metals Magnetic? No, all metals are not magnetic. The noble metals, metals such as aluminum, copper and it's alloys, and even some ferrous metals such as stainless steel are non-magnetic. In some of the metals that are not magnetic, the localized magnetic domains cancel each other out since they point in different directions.

Steel Slag

Steel slag is another commonly used recycled material in road construction. Steel slag is a solid waste generated in the process of steel making and is mainly composed of oxides of calcium, iron, silicon, magnesium, and some other elements.
